The Dean’s List – “Hollywood” (Ft. Dani Ummel)

Boston’s very own, The Dean’s List, are back once again with another track from their upcoming album Generation X. Nearly a month ago, we covered the album’s first single, “Youth,” but today we’re presenting y’all with the album’s second early release: “Youth.” Rapped over a murky grit, group member Sonny Shotz uses his sarcastic squawk to cut a path through a smoky room– all while socializing and buying drinks for people as he passes by. Along the way, he bumps into fellow Boston dweller/crooner Dani Ummel, whose airy vocals will crash upon you like a wave does the shoreline. She’ll pull you onto the dance floor with her voice and leave you dancing with a shadow. Her voice is as mysterious as the instrumentation is gorged with synth reverberations. “Hollywood” is the sort of piece that’ll eviscerate you. It’s the sort of song that’ll make you feel as lonely and bereft of love as a night on the Sunset Strip.
